2, HAWTHORNE AVENUE, SCOTTER, GAINSBOROUGH, DN21 3UN - £202,500

2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E is a midsized extended detached house of 124m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975. It was last sold for £202,500 in September 2019, which was around 12% below the average September 2019 detached price in the West Lindsey local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was June 2019,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was C.

2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the West Lindsey local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E sales from July 2007 and September 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 2007 sale was for 6%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 6% below the HPI over time, until the September 2019 sale, where it falls to 12%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 12% below the HPI.

2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E: Plot and Title Map

2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E sits on a plot of roughly 0.124 of an acre, or 503m². The below map shows the location of 2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 2 HAWTHORNE AVENUE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
